Output 1129786a672f5bb2fbc0a26b8f3bb3ce7b64fcbaba3473f74a9d229cc9a6d8ed:1

value
40815060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5441f383f66ce150934e33726181d047f2546844 OP_EQUAL
address
39NXh2fNuHBWPqkRZSHnPWdXxvvy1wuE67
transaction
1129786a672f5bb2fbc0a26b8f3bb3ce7b64fcbaba3473f74a9d229cc9a6d8ed
confirmations
558300
spent
true